**Ceremony item 4 — Hermetic build migration signing keys.** As discussed at the weekly eng sync, the Bramblewick pipeline is moving to the Orrin hermetic build system, and this ceremony generates the new provenance signing keys. Please verify the sealed toolchain hashes match the printed manifest, confirm no network egress during keygen, and have both custodians initial each page. Because the old keys are retired today, recovery depends entirely on the escrow record. The escrowed recovery passphrase appears directly below.

strongbox words: gilok-druion-briath-wendor-briion-prawyn-fenion-oliir-casdor-holius-briius-gilath-gilael-pelys

This was ambiguous once volumetric conversion landed, so it is now `SCALE_ROUNDING_STRATEGY`, accepting `banker`, `ceiling`, or `fractional`. The old name is honored with a deprecation warning until 4.0; update any `.env` files during your next deploy. Note that the conversion service now validates requests against the Quillbrook pricing API, which means each environment must carry an API credential, and the entry belongs on the following line.

env line for fafof-fahag: LEDGER_TOKEN5=f8790

Handover — Pixelbin image cache leak

For Marisol (release mgmt): the leak is in Pixelbin's thumbnail cache. Evictions fire but decoded bitmaps are retained by the preview listener — refs never released. Repro: scroll any gallery 10 min, RSS climbs ~40MB. Fix is half-done on branch `cache-detach`; Torvald has context. Hold the 4.2 release until it lands. Heap dump archive is sealed; unlock it with the passphrase below.

unlock words, hahip-baduf: holwyn-istath-julvan